Mcu kinetis compiler pdf file

Command shows the location of the compiler executable file. These demos can be adapted to any microcontroller within a supported microcontroller family. Using another freescale 32bit mcu not kinetis k40 question asked by isro hutama on may 11, 20. Kinetis mcus are supported by a marketleading enablement bundle from freescale and numerous arm 3rd party ecosystem partners. The sections are allocated to segments in the order given in sections block of lcf file. Sensor fusion library for kinetis mcus lendo os movimentos da iot d e z. Kinetis mcus offer exceptional lowpower performance, scalability and feature integration. The mcuxpresso sdk brings open source drivers, middleware, and reference example applications to speed your software development. The kinetis gcc build tools reference manual for microcontrollers describes usage of. It supports cortexm based kinetis devices and integrates with processor expert and kinetis software development kit. The purpose of this document is to introduce micromonitorm micromonitor for mcus on kinetis mcus. Ide compiler capabilities include many utilities to aid in program design and editing.

Picmicro mcu c compilers custom computer services inc. Many of my currently active projects are using kinetis design studio kds v3. For detailed information we invite you to view this notification online change category wafer fab process assembly process. Getting started with umonm and the kinetis k6x mcu last update. We will take you through all the steps, one by one, and show you how simple and easy it is to use any of our compilers. The c source files and header files generated by freescale processor expert have been automatically added into the project of iar embedded workbench, in the group generatedcs and generatedhs respectively. The support team also monitors these forums to provide answers and take your feedback. Usbdm usbdm bdm interface for freescale microcontrollers usbdm consists of two components. Power management for kinetis mcus nxp semiconductors. Download the demo file from the link below, then drag and drop bubbletwrkl28z72m.

The kinetis design studio software development tool is a gnueclipsebased development environment for freescale kinetis devices. This document uses the freescale kinetis twrk60n512. Devices start from 8 kb of flash and a small footprint of 1. Customer information notification 201710023i issue date. When creating a project for kinetis design studio, it asks me which compiler i want to use. Jlinkobk22 user guide of the onboard debug probe based. This manual is to be read by persons who have a basic knowledge of each mcu micro controller unit. Introduction mcu bootloader demo applications users guide, revision 3, may 2018 nxp. This document describes how to use the mcu bootloader to load a user application on a kinetis mcu. Comparing codewarrior with kinetis design studio dzone java. If the compiler optimization dial is turned in an attempt to improve code density, code sequences like this may get optimized out. Kinetis software development kit farnell element14. Variables are added in lcf and these can be used in application as well as internally in linker tool for computation. New functionality including support for new devices and other fsl architectures can be added to codewarrior development studio for microcontrollers v10.

The discussion is centered on umonm on the k64f freedom platform and uumon on the k60 twrk60n512 with twrser. However, the build scripts that rely on the arm gcc compiler are written in python. This works great, as eclipse has all the necessary tools to edit, build and debug it. C51 is a bit archaic in terms of language support keil chose to implement c90, and has never gone back to update the compiler to the c99 or c11 standards. The project creation is as for the kinetis design studio which uses gnu gcc. Before you ask a question, please search the community to find if someone has already offered a. Twrkv10z32 mcu module the jumpers of the twrkv10z32 mcu module and the twrmclv3ph module must be configured correctly. Welcome to the kinetis software development kit sdk community. The k40, k53, kwikstik or other boards can also be used. You may not extract portions of this manual or modify the pdf file in any way without the prior. Compare the best free open source windows cross compilers software at sourceforge. The flagship frdmk64f has been designed by nxp in collaboration with mbed for prototyping all sorts of devices, especially those requiring optimized size and price points.

Before you ask a question, please search the community to. I have been playing with a frdm k64f board and found it. Except that in the last dialog of the wizard i select either iar or keil to be used as compiler. Features include easy access to mcu io, batteryready, lowpower operation, a standardbased form factor with expansion board options and a builtin debug interface for flash programming. Chapter 2 build properties for arm gcc codewarrior development studio for microcontrollers v10. Free, secure and fast windows cross compilers software downloads from the largest open source applications and software directory. Im using eclipse based ides to develop and debug my embedded applications. Mx 8m plus applications processor with integrated neural net processing acceleration. The compiler tells the commandline tool to preprocess source files. Customer information notification 201710023i digikey. Fixed issue with file path handling when importing examples or creating new projects with certain sdks previously made available as a hotfix to ide v11. Gnu mcu eclipse is an open source project that includes a family of eclipse plugins and tools for multiplatform embedded arm and riscv development, based on gnu toolchains. Kinetis l series mcus provide ultralow dynamic consumption, ultralow static consumption, rich lowpower modes and innovative lowpower peripherals. Has anyone any experience successful preferably at exporting code from mbed to kinetis sdk.

Power architecture processor projects are not so lucky. The former project was hosted on github and sourceforge. Anyone can read the discussions, but only registered members of can post questions and comments. An4942, getting started with kinetis ea series mcus.

The software tools used for building your application assembler, linker, c compiler. Codewarrior project for power architecture products use. Dont see an exact match for your microcontroller part number and compiler vendor choice. An5282, codewarrior to s32 design studio s32ds migration. See the creating a new freertos application and adapting a freertos demo documentation pages.

Kinetis software development kit the kinetis sdk includes a hardware abstraction layer hal and drivers for each mcu peripheral, usb and connectivity stacks, middleware, realtime operating systems and example applications designed to simplify and accelerate application development on kinetis mcus. Simplicity studio uses keil c51, the industrystandard 8051 compiler. Jlinkobk22 user guide of the onboard debug probe based on kinetis k22 mcu. Experience a world of technologies that help products sense, think, connect, and act. I have only tested the mbed build scripts with python 2. Code size information with gcc for armkinetis mcu on. But when it comes just to downloadflash a binary to the board, then things are pretty much specific to the tools used.

View file edit file delete file binary file not shown. Create a new project with menu file new kinetis project. The compiler described in this manual conforms about c language to the american national standard for information systems programming language c, x3. An4942 rev 0, 052014 getting started with kinetis ea series mcus. The goal of this page is to help you make your first project in the compiler and understand how the ide operates. Srecord generation with gcc for armkinetis mcu on eclipse. Welcome to the kinetis design studio ide community. Study of melodies, intervals, harmony, and solfege in lydian, mixolydian, dorian, and the ear training core, in combination with arranging, harmony, conducting, tonal harmony and counterpoint, and. Gnu gcc is here the default compiler for the kinetis l family.

I would expect that this kind of simple thing would be there, but. Welcome to the mikroelektronika compiler quick start guide. Using eclipse to program binary files to an embedded target. With the advent of gcc for kinetis in codewarrior for mcu10. Customize and download an sdk specific to your processor or evaluation board selections. S32ds features a codewarrior project importer for kea mcus that allows a user to migrate a codewarrior kea mcu project to s32ds with a click of a button, because codewarrior projects for kea mcus and s32ds both use the gcc compiler.

Bldc motor control reference solution package users guide. Bin eagleintrorobot k22intro robot shield schematic. Codewarrior development studio for microcontrollers, v10. As many ides are now based on eclipse, also see the page that. Using iar embedded workbench for freescale kinetis mcu. Since the efm8 is an 8051compatible mcu, simplicity studio will work perfectly. The kinetis kl0x mcu family provides a bridge for 8bit customers migrating into the kinetis mcu portfolio, and is software and tool compatible with all other kinetis l series families.